Do I Really Know My Risk?

March 23, 2023

I mean, do I really know my risk?

Stocks and Futures traders like to talk about how they use stop-loss orders to define their risks, and that’s smart.

A lifetime ago I managed a small, independent hedge fund that traded commodities with a trend-following strategy. This strategy entered positions that I’d attempt to hold for weeks or months (if they were working).

Every position I had on had a resting stop-loss order working in the market, giving me comfort that I knew the most I could lose if I was wrong.

All that comfort I was enjoying changed one day after a trip to my clearing firm’s office in downtown Chicago.

It’s Time To Get Bonds Back into the Fold

March 23, 2023

From the Desk of Ian Culley @IanCulley

The Federal Reserve handed down a 25-basis-point rate increase on Wednesday.

And Fed Chair Jerome Powell implied an impending pause in the hiking cycle.

You know what this means...

It’s time to buy the four "Bs" – Bonds, Bitcoin, Big-Tech, and Bullion.

JC and Strazza talked about it on Pardon the Price Action earlier this week.

Today, I’ll highlight bonds with a couple key levels to trade against as we add these assets to our portfolios.

First up is the 7-10 Year US Treasury ETF $IEF:

It’s not there yet. But if and when IEF reclaims the critical shelf of former lows at approximately 100, we’re long!

The next potential resistance level hangs overhead at last year’s August pivot high of 105.75. This is a logical level to take profits or “feed the ducks.”
